The Reservoir Hill Neighborhood is in the final stages of an overwhelming renaissance that has transformed this historic and beautiful community to its earlier popularity for Victorian architecture, tree-lined streets and easy access to downtown and county sites. This historic 19th century neighborhood is home to artists, educators, and city leaders; contain historic churches and synagogues; boast one of the most diverse, intact collection of late 19th and early 20th century urban architecture in the Baltimore City; and border the second largest urban park in the country, Druid Hill Park. Baltimore's first large municipal park, Druid Hill, is commonly known for its shady lawns, rolling hills, picturesque water features, and majestic forest. There are picnic groves and shelters, facilities for tennis, baseball, lacrosse, swimming, as well as The Maryland Zoo. For more information, please visit the Reservoir Hill Improvement Council |
